Developing Soccer Skills Through Professional Soccer Coaching

Though professional soccer teams make the game look easy, it's usually the exact opposite for newbies of the sport. The skills displayed by pros during competition are a result of years of soccer coaching rendered by the best management teams.

Some people don't realize that in order to become great and compete against expert teams during actual sporting events, it's important to put in 100% effort and devote a lot of their time to make this happen. Soccer is no different from taking on a profession in other fields of work - that's why players need to attend a specialized academy or learning institute to further develop their skills.

The student will undergo rigorous training until he has achieved a skillset that's good enough to land him into the professional leagues. Of course, a hopeful shouldn't just wait for some club to approach him and offer a chance to play amongst the big boys - considering the enormous amount of other talented individuals who also deserve a shot at stardom, it's always better to be the one to make the first move.

For those having difficulty getting onto clubs, or even playing for local amateur soccer teams, there are several tips that can help any individual push himself further. First tip that's regularly handed out by the majority of soccer coaching experts is to set realistic goals.

Objectives may include a variety of elements which relate directly to performance, such as being able to score with both legs, dribbling the ball quicker and with more dexterity, or boosting overall speed and stamina. Writing these goals down in a notebook and monitoring progress is a great way to enhance skills and performance.

Another tip is to give 100% effort during practice sessions - if the apprentice doesn't give his all while training, then it's likely he wouldn't do the same during the game. Moreover, a student should also consider practicing on his own while not training with the group.

Pros who belong to big-name soccer teams know that living a disciplined lifestyle is essential to their success. Getting enough sleep every night, saying no to alcohol, tobacco, and other vices detrimental to human health is a must. Anyone who wishes to strive in this physically strenuous game needs to place importance to their overall physical health.

Lastly, here's the most vital soccer coaching tip of all: perseverance. Becoming great doesn't happen overnight. To become adept at the sport, a great deal of time and effort needs to be given. When all hope seems lost, a wise course of action would be to revise training regimens, and keep working towards improving.
